Boeing Defense, Space & Security (BDS) is hiring for an Experienced Staff Analyst to support our Space and Intelligence delivery team in El Segundo and other sites . This ideal candidate will work cross-functionally with various to build relationships and support the needs of our teammates. You will have the opportunity to develop a deep understanding of the various programs and sites that we deliver training to. This position is fully virtual. To be successful in the role, you should have a demonstrated ability to collaborate and integrate across functions, demonstrated project execution skills, and be a self-starter with initiative who has a deep passion for our employees.
Position Responsibilities:
Manages and provides reporting for staffing on the program, including the use of the Adaptive Planning tool . Plans and coordinates organizational facility requirements. Develops and deploys localized organizational information . Provides data for management review and tracks execution of the plan to communicate status to all project participants . Conducts research and analyzes data from multiple sources. Delivers informational or organizational materials to senior leaders . Provides logistics and facilitation of personnel seating and moves between buildings . Collaborates with subject matter experts, suppliers, partners and customers to deploy broad organizational onboarding and training . This position is fully remote. The selected candidate will be required to work virtually and collaborate with the other staff analyst across the Space and intelligence portfolio.
